Showcasing a wonderful performance, Delhi Public School (DPS) bagged the winner’s trophy at Sahodya Complex U-19 inter-school Basket Ball Tournament. The three-day tournament concluded on Saturday at St Joseph’s Coed School.
To mark the closure of the tournament, the final matches were played between the teams in both the categories.
In girls category, the final match was played between DPS and St Joseph’s Coed School. In this match exhibiting the brilliant performance, the team of DPS won the match with 5 points. DPS bagged the winner’s trophy in this category.
Besides, in boys category, the final match was played between DPS and St Joseph’s Coed in which again DPS showcased a brilliant performance and won the match. In this category too, DPS bagged the winner’s trophy.
